Basic Troubleshooting Steps

Before we dive into more advanced troubleshooting, let’s start with some basic checks to ensure that your Turtle Beach mic is properly connected and configured.

Check the Physical Connection

Make sure that your Turtle Beach mic is properly connected to your Xbox One controller. Ensure that the microphone is securely plugged into the 3.5mm audio jack on the controller. If you’re using a wireless Turtle Beach mic, check that it’s properly paired with your Xbox One.

Check the Mic Settings

On your Xbox One, go to Settings > Devices & accessories > Audio devices. Ensure that the Turtle Beach mic is selected as the default microphone device. If it’s not, select it and restart your Xbox One.

Check the Mic Volume

Increase the mic volume to the maximum level to ensure that it’s not muted or turned down too low. You can do this by going to Settings > Devices & accessories > Audio devices, and adjusting the mic volume slider.

Restart Your Xbox One

Sometimes, a simple reboot can resolve the issue. Restart your Xbox One and try using your Turtle Beach mic again.

Advanced Troubleshooting Steps

If the basic troubleshooting steps didn’t resolve the issue, let’s dive deeper into more advanced troubleshooting steps.

Check for Mic Faults

Inspect your Turtle Beach mic for any signs of physical damage, such as cuts or frays in the cord, or damage to the microphone itself. If your mic is damaged, try using a different one to see if the problem persists.

Update Your Turtle Beach Mic Firmware

Outdated firmware can cause compatibility issues with your Xbox One. Check the Turtle Beach website for firmware updates and follow their instructions to update your mic.

Reset Your Turtle Beach Mic

Some Turtle Beach mics have a reset button. Check your user manual or the manufacturer’s website to see if this is an option for your specific model. Resetting your mic can resolve configuration issues.

Check for Conflicting Devices

If you have other audio devices connected to your Xbox One, such as a headset or speakers, try disconnecting them and see if your Turtle Beach mic starts working again. Conflicting devices can cause audio issues.

Xbox One Settings and Configurations

Let’s explore some Xbox One settings and configurations that might be causing the issue.

Chat Audio Settings

Go to Settings > Preferences > Chat audio settings. Ensure that the “Chat audio” option is set to “On” and the “Chat microphone” option is set to your Turtle Beach mic.

Party Chat Settings

If you’re experiencing issues in party chat, go to Settings > Preferences > Party chat settings. Ensure that the “Party chat” option is set to “On” and the “Party chat microphone” option is set to your Turtle Beach mic.

Audio Output Settings

Go to Settings > Preferences > Audio output settings. Ensure that the “Audio output” option is set to “Stereo” or “Surround sound” and not “PCM”. PCM can cause compatibility issues with some Turtle Beach mics.

Can I use a different Xbox One controller with my Turtle Beach headset?

If you’re experiencing issues with your Turtle Beach mic on your existing Xbox One controller, try using a different controller to see if the problem persists. Sometimes, a faulty controller can cause connectivity issues with your headset. If the mic works with the new controller, it’s likely that the issue lies with the original controller.

Make sure to pair your Turtle Beach headset with the new controller by following the same pairing process as before. If the mic still doesn’t work, it’s possible that the problem lies with the headset itself or the Xbox One console.
